Abstract

The present invention relates to a stable dispersoidal liquid soap cleansing composition comprising: PA1 (A) from about 5% to about 20% by weight of potassium fatty acid soap; PA1 (B) from about 2.5% to about 18% C.sub.8 -C.sub.22 free fatty acid; PA1 (C) from about 55% to about 90% water; and PA1 (D) from about 0.1% to about 4% of a stabilizer selected from the group consisting of: from about 0.1% to about 3.0% of an electrolyte; and from 0% to about 2.0% of a polymeric thickener; and mixtures thereof; and wherein said fatty acid of said (A) and (B) has an Iodine Value of from zero to about 15; and a titer of from about 44 to about 70; wherein said soap and said free fatty acid have a weight ratio of about 1:0.3 to about 1:1; and wherein said liquid has an initial viscosity of from about 4,000 cps to about 100,000 cps at 25.degree. C. and a Cycle Viscosity of from about 10,000 cps to about 100,000 cps at 25.degree. C.
